Varidata 新聞資訊
知識庫 | 問答 | 最新技術 | IDC 行業新聞最新消息
Varidata 知識文檔
如何檢查託管在美國伺服器IP上的網域名稱
發布日期:2025-12-04

了解美國伺服器IP位址上託管了多少個網域名稱對系統管理員、安全研究人員和伺服器租用供應商來說至關重要。無論您是在調查伺服器資源、執行安全稽核,還是分析競爭對手的基礎設施,IP反向查詢都是您技術工具庫中不可或缺的工具。本綜合指南將探討IP反向查詢和網域名稱發現的進階技術,結合命令列專業知識和專業線上服務。
理解IP反向查詢基礎知識
IP反向查詢,也稱為反向DNS查詢,使我們能夠發現指向特定IP位址的所有網域名稱。與將網域名稱轉換為IP位址的傳統正向DNS查詢不同,反向查詢按相反方向運作,揭示託管在單一伺服器上的完整網域名稱生態系統。此技術在以下情況下特別有價值:
- 調查共享伺服器租用環境
- 執行安全評估
- 分析競爭對手基礎設施
- 排查DNS問題
- 監控伺服器資源配置
該過程利用DNS中的PTR(指標)記錄,將IP位址對應到網域名稱。理解這種關係對成功的網域名稱發現和分析至關重要。
網域名稱發現的基本命令列工具
對於技術精通的專業人士和系統管理員來說,命令列工具提供了無與倫比的靈活性和功能。這些工具構成了自動化網域名稱偵察的骨幹:
- nslookup:
- 基本語法:nslookup -type=ptr IP_ADDRESS
- 支援多次查詢的互動模式
- 適用於Windows、Linux和macOS
- 適合快速DNS記錄驗證
- dig (網域名稱資訊查詢器):
- 進階語法:dig -x IP_ADDRESS +short
- 提供詳細查詢資訊
- 支援DNSSEC驗證
- 提供廣泛的格式化選項
- whois:
- 顯示網域名稱註冊詳情
- 識別伺服器租用供應商
- 顯示管理聯絡人
- 提供網域名稱建立/到期日期
這是結合這些工具的實際示例:
# 基本反向查詢 dig -x 192.0.2.1 +short # 詳細PTR記錄查詢 dig -x 192.0.2.1 +noall +answer # 帶過濾輸出的WHOIS查詢 whois 192.0.2.1 | grep "Domain Name"
線上反向IP查詢服務
雖然命令列工具提供精細控制,但專業的線上服務提供額外功能和使用者友善界面。以下是最有效的平台:
- ViewDNS.info:
- 全面的網域名稱分析
- 歷史DNS記錄
- 批次查詢功能
- 免費和進階選項
- DNSlytics:
- 進階反向IP查詢
- 網域名稱關係映射
- SSL憑證分析
- 定期資料庫更新
- SecurityTrails:
- 企業級DNS情報
- 歷史資料存取
- API整合選項
- 綜合報告工具
進階查詢技術
為最大化網域名稱發現的效率和準確性,實施這些進階技術:
- 批次處理自動化:
- 批次處理的Python指令碼示例:
import dns.resolver import concurrent.futures def reverse_lookup(ip): try: answers = dns.resolver.resolve_address(ip) return [str(rdata.target) for rdata in answers] except: return [] def bulk_lookup(ip_list): with concurrent.futures.ThreadPoolExecutor(max_workers=10) as executor: results = executor.map(reverse_lookup, ip_list) return list(results) - 結果驗證協定:
- 交叉引用多個DNS伺服器
- 實施HTTP回應驗證
- 檢查SSL憑證主題備用名稱
- 驗證網域名稱年齡和註冊狀態
最佳實踐和最佳化
使用這些經過產業測試的實踐最佳化您的反向IP查詢流程:
- 速率限制實施:
- 使用指數退避重試
- 實施請求佇列
- 監控API使用閾值
- 在多個端點之間分配請求
- 資料管理:
- 實施帶TTL的本地快取
- 使用結構化資料格式(JSON/CSV)
- 維護稽核日誌
- 定期快取失效
安全注意事項
在反向IP查詢期間維護強大的安全協定:
- 身份驗證和授權:
- 安全使用API金鑰
- 實施請求簽名
- 監控未授權存取
- 定期安全稽核
- 資料隱私合規:
- GDPR考慮
- 資料保留政策
- 存取控制機制
- 稽核追蹤維護
效能最佳化策略
使用這些進階策略提升查詢效能:
- DNS解析最佳化:
- 實施DNS預取
- 使用任播DNS服務
- 設定最佳TTL值
- 監控解析延遲
- 資源利用:
- 負載平衡設定
- 記憶體管理技術
- 連線池
- 請求限流機制
故障排除指南
使用這些解決方案解決常見挑戰:
- DNS傳播問題:
- 針對多個DNS供應商驗證
- 考慮傳播延遲
- 實施重試機制
- 監控DNS健康指標
- 速率限制管理:
- 實施漸進延遲
- 使用多個API金鑰
- 監控使用模式
- 最佳化請求排程
未來考慮
為不斷演進的網域名稱查詢挑戰做好準備:
- 新興技術:
- IPv6採用影響
- DNSSEC實施
- DoH (DNS over HTTPS)
- 新頂級網域名稱考慮
掌握IP反向查詢技術對有效的伺服器管理和安全分析至關重要。透過將命令列專業知識與專業工具相結合並遵循這些最佳實踐,您可以高效地發現和分析美國伺服器租用伺服器上的網域名稱關係。記得保持適當的文件記錄,遵循安全協定,並及時了解最新的DNS技術和反向查詢方法。

